The video tutorial guides viewers through a challenging task of crossing a cable with a boat. It begins with an introduction to the challenge, followed by detailed instructions on preparing and executing the crossing. The tutorial emphasizes the importance of speed, motor control, and timing. The video concludes with a reflection on the experience, highlighting the confidence gained and the need for practice to master the skill.
